Skip to content

Commit 78574a2

Browse files
Merge pull request #186 from clcollins/bump_ocm_sdk_version
bump ocm sdk version
2 parents 0460b93 + 6cdb645 commit 78574a2

File tree

4 files changed

+54
-6
lines changed

4 files changed

+54
-6
lines changed
Lines changed: 44 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,44 @@
1+
# Create a project release automatically on tag creation
2+
3+
name: create_release_on_tag
4+
5+
on:
6+
push:
7+
tags:
8+
- "*" # triggers only if push new tag version, like `0.8.4`
9+
10+
jobs:
11+
build:
12+
name: create_release_on_tag
13+
runs-on: ubuntu-latest
14+
permissions:
15+
repository-projects: write
16+
17+
steps:
18+
- name: Check out code into the Go module directory
19+
uses: actions/checkout@v2.3.3
20+
with:
21+
fetch-depth: 0 # See: https://goreleaser.com/ci/actions/
22+
23+
- name: Set up Go
24+
uses: actions/setup-go@v2.1.3
25+
with:
26+
go-version: 1.16.8
27+
id: go
28+
29+
- name: Download GoReleaser
30+
run: |
31+
mkdir ./bin && curl -sSLf https://github.com/goreleaser/goreleaser/releases/latest/download/goreleaser_Linux_x86_64.tar.gz -o - | tar --extract --gunzip --directory ./bin goreleaser
32+
33+
- name: Check goreleaser validity
34+
run: |
35+
./bin/goreleaser check
36+
37+
- name: Run GoReleaser
38+
uses: goreleaser/goreleaser-action@master
39+
with:
40+
version: latest
41+
args: release --rm-dist
42+
env:
43+
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
44+

.github/workflows/validate_goreleaser.yml

Lines changed: 4 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-15,19 +15,21 @@ jobs:
1515
runs-on: ubuntu-latest
1616

1717
steps:
18-
- name: Checkout
18+
- name: Check out code into the Go module directory
1919
uses: actions/checkout@v2.3.3
2020
with:
21-
fetch-depth: 0
21+
fetch-depth: 0 # See: https://goreleaser.com/ci/actions/
2222

2323
- name: Set up Go
2424
uses: actions/setup-go@v2.1.3
2525
with:
2626
go-version: 1.15.2
27+
id: go
2728

2829
- name: Download GoReleaser
2930
run: |
3031
mkdir ./bin && curl -sSLf https://github.com/goreleaser/goreleaser/releases/latest/download/goreleaser_Linux_x86_64.tar.gz -o - | tar --extract --gunzip --directory ./bin goreleaser
32+
3133
- name: Check goreleaser validity
3234
run: |
3335
./bin/goreleaser check

go.mod

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-8,9 +8,9 @@ require (
88
github.com/golang/mock v1.5.0
99
github.com/imdario/mergo v0.3.12 // indirect
1010
github.com/kr/text v0.2.0 // indirect
11-
github.com/onsi/gomega v1.13.0
11+
github.com/onsi/gomega v1.16.0
1212
github.com/openshift-online/ocm-cli v0.1.59
13-
github.com/openshift-online/ocm-sdk-go v0.1.204
13+
github.com/openshift-online/ocm-sdk-go v0.1.205
1414
github.com/openshift/api v3.9.1-0.20191111211345-a27ff30ebf09+incompatible
1515
github.com/openshift/aws-account-operator/pkg/apis v0.0.0-20210611151019-01b1df7a3e9e
1616
github.com/openshift/gcp-project-operator v0.0.0-20210906153132-ce9b2425f1a7

go.sum

Lines changed: 4 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1832,8 +1832,9 @@ github.com/onsi/gomega v1.7.1/go.mod h1:XdKZgCCFLUoM/7CFJVPcG8C1xQ1AJ0vpAezJrB7J
18321832
github.com/onsi/gomega v1.8.1/go.mod h1:Ho0h+IUsWyvy1OpqCwxlQ/21gkhVunqlU8fDGcoTdcA=
18331833
github.com/onsi/gomega v1.9.0/go.mod h1:Ho0h+IUsWyvy1OpqCwxlQ/21gkhVunqlU8fDGcoTdcA=
18341834
github.com/onsi/gomega v1.10.1/go.mod h1:iN09h71vgCQne3DLsj+A5owkum+a2tYe+TOCB1ybHNo=
1835-
github.com/onsi/gomega v1.13.0 h1:7lLHu94wT9Ij0o6EWWclhu0aOh32VxhkwEJvzuWPeak=
18361835
github.com/onsi/gomega v1.13.0/go.mod h1:lRk9szgn8TxENtWd0Tp4c3wjlRfMTMH27I+3Je41yGY=
1836+
github.com/onsi/gomega v1.16.0 h1:6gjqkI8iiRHMvdccRJM8rVKjCWk6ZIm6FTm3ddIe4/c=
1837+
github.com/onsi/gomega v1.16.0/go.mod h1:HnhC7FXeEQY45zxNK3PPoIUhzk/80Xly9PcubAlGdZY=
18371838
github.com/op/go-logging v0.0.0-20160315200505-970db520ece7/go.mod h1:HzydrMdWErDVzsI23lYNej1Htcns9BCg93Dk0bBINWk=
18381839
github.com/opencontainers/go-digest v0.0.0-20170106003457-a6d0ee40d420/go.mod h1:cMLVZDEM3+U2I4VmLI6N8jQYUd2OVphdqWwCJHrFt2s=
18391840
github.com/opencontainers/go-digest v0.0.0-20180430190053-c9281466c8b2/go.mod h1:cMLVZDEM3+U2I4VmLI6N8jQYUd2OVphdqWwCJHrFt2s=
@@ -1849,8 +1850,9 @@ github.com/opencontainers/runtime-tools v0.0.0-20181011054405-1d69bd0f9c39/go.mo
18491850
github.com/openshift-metal3/terraform-provider-ironic v0.2.1/go.mod h1:G79T6t60oBpYfZK/x960DRzYsNHdz5YVCHINx6QlmtU=
18501851
github.com/openshift-online/ocm-cli v0.1.59 h1:yS32dQInuBi572wL5rAEvycbnRaV6MXkroS4O9wVGl8=
18511852
github.com/openshift-online/ocm-cli v0.1.59/go.mod h1:z5MCjQ8Frc7Bhv59rp0deR2kyEs8901uie95+Xk7THY=
1852-
github.com/openshift-online/ocm-sdk-go v0.1.204 h1:SWqCItOqSTneVYjowFhtdevwlNFv5PXApeej2orO1pg=
18531853
github.com/openshift-online/ocm-sdk-go v0.1.204/go.mod h1:RNoKwEJaFMJJvKWKPzv5iQvRau/eHL7py6eOhCgnfwU=
1854+
github.com/openshift-online/ocm-sdk-go v0.1.205 h1:DhvfTf55jpQsTFpI283/z3b0Tab8x26oelPDuao7IiM=
1855+
github.com/openshift-online/ocm-sdk-go v0.1.205/go.mod h1:iOhkt/6nFp9v7hasdmGbYlR/YKeUoaZKq5ZBrtyKwKg=
18541856
github.com/openshift/api v0.0.0-20200205133042-34f0ec8dab87/go.mod h1:fT6U/JfG8uZzemTRwZA2kBDJP5nWz7v05UHnty/D+pk=
18551857
github.com/openshift/api v0.0.0-20200320142426-0de0d539b0c3/go.mod h1:7k3+uZYOir97walbYUqApHUA2OPhkQpVJHt0n7GJ6P4=
18561858
github.com/openshift/api v0.0.0-20200323095748-e7041f8762a3/go.mod h1:7k3+uZYOir97walbYUqApHUA2OPhkQpVJHt0n7GJ6P4=

0 commit comments

Comments
 (0)